Career Path

In the UK, the demand for professionals with expertise in neuroscience and early childhood education is rising. Here are some roles that are seeing significant growth in this field: - **Early Childhood Educators**: With a Postgraduate Certificate in Neuroscience in Early Childhood Education, early childhood educators can gain a deeper understanding of how young children learn and develop. This knowledge can help them create more effective learning environments and improve the outcomes of the children they work with. - **Neuroscience Researchers**: Neuroscience researchers study the brain and nervous system to understand how they influence behaviour and cognition. In the context of early childhood education, neuroscience researchers might investigate the impact of early experiences on brain development or develop interventions to promote healthy brain development. - **Psychologists**: Psychologists study human behaviour and mental processes. Those with a background in neuroscience and early childhood education might focus on the cognitive, social, and emotional development of young children. - **Education Consultants**: Education consultants work with schools and other educational organizations to improve teaching and learning. Those with expertise in neuroscience and early childhood education might provide guidance on how to design effective learning experiences for young children. - **Speech-Language Pathologists**: Speech-language pathologists diagnose and treat communication and swallowing disorders. Those with a background in neuroscience and early childhood education might specialize in working with young children who have language delays or disorders. According to recent job market trends, the salary ranges for these roles vary. Early childhood educators can expect to earn between £18,000 and £30,000 per year, while neuroscience researchers might earn between £30,000 and £60,000 per year. Psychologists and education consultants can earn between £35,000 and £70,000 per year, while speech-language pathologists can earn between £25,000 and £50,000 per year.
